The majestic and regal William Regal started NXT on the right note this week, with a contract signing segment. Usually, all of these segments lead into a flurry of fists or a broken table by the end. This week, there was none of that but a lot of strong words were exchanged for sure. That was undoubtedly a refreshing change.
Ford and Dawkins have made RAW and the main roster their home in the past few weeks. They even had a very interesting segment with Kurt Angle in the main roster with all of them chugging down a shot of milk. But it is clear that they do have some unfinished business in NXT.
However, this could be a giveaway that they're losing the titles at TakeOver. The Undisputed ERA will clearly be the bigger deal, in the upcoming weeks on NXT TV.
